What is RAM and How Does it Work?

Before we dive into the specifics of shutting down a computer and its effect on RAM, it’s essential to understand what RAM is and how it works. RAM, or Random Access Memory, is a type of computer memory that temporarily stores data and applications while a computer is running. It’s called “random access” because the computer can quickly access and retrieve data from any location in the memory.

RAM is a volatile memory technology, meaning that its contents are lost when the computer is powered off. This is in contrast to non-volatile memory technologies like hard drives and solid-state drives, which retain their data even when the computer is turned off.

How RAM is Used by the Computer

When you open an application or program on your computer, it is loaded into RAM. The computer uses RAM to store the application’s code, data, and any variables or settings that are required for it to run. While the application is running, the computer can quickly access and retrieve the data it needs from RAM, allowing for fast and efficient performance.

In addition to storing application data, RAM is also used to store the computer’s operating system and any background processes that are running. This includes things like the taskbar, system tray, and any other system-level processes that are required for the computer to function.

What Happens to RAM When You Shut Down Your Computer?

Now that we understand what RAM is and how it works, let’s explore what happens to it when you shut down your computer. When you shut down your computer, the power to the RAM is turned off, and the data that is stored in it is lost. This is because RAM is a volatile memory technology, as mentioned earlier.

When the power is turned off, the electrical charges that store the data in RAM dissipate, and the data is lost. This means that any applications or data that were stored in RAM are no longer available when the computer is turned back on.

Does Shutting Down Your Computer Clear RAM?

So, to answer the question, yes, shutting down your computer does clear its RAM. When the power is turned off, the data that is stored in RAM is lost, and the memory is cleared.

However, it’s worth noting that some computers may have a feature called “suspend” or “hibernate” that allows the computer to save the contents of RAM to the hard drive or solid-state drive before shutting down. This allows the computer to quickly restore the contents of RAM when it is turned back on, making it seem like the RAM was not cleared.

What is the difference between RAM and storage?

RAM (Random Access Memory) and storage are two different types of computer memory. RAM is a volatile memory technology that temporarily stores data and applications while a computer is running. Storage, on the other hand, refers to non-volatile memory technologies such as hard drives, solid-state drives, and flash drives, which store data permanently even when the power is turned off.

The key difference between RAM and storage is that RAM is used for short-term memory, while storage is used for long-term memory. RAM is used to store data and applications that are currently being used, while storage is used to store data and applications that are not currently being used but need to be retained for later use. When a computer is shut down, the contents of RAM are lost, but the contents of storage remain intact.

Is it better to shut down or put a computer to sleep?

Whether it is better to shut down or put a computer to sleep depends on the specific situation. Shutting down a computer completely powers down the system, which can help conserve energy and reduce wear and tear on the computer’s components. However, shutting down a computer also means that any open applications and unsaved work will be lost.

Putting a computer to sleep, on the other hand, allows the computer to enter a low-power state while still retaining the current state of open applications and unsaved work. This can be convenient for users who need to quickly resume work where they left off. However, putting a computer to sleep does not completely power down the system, which means that it will continue to consume some power even when not in use.
